124.601 Definitions.

Sec. 1.

As used in this act:

(a) “Authority” means an authority incorporated under this act.

(b) “Emergency services” means fire protection services, emergency medical services, police protection, and any other emergency health or safety services designated in the articles of incorporation of an authority.

(c) “Incorporating municipality” means a municipality that becomes part of a new authority in the manner provided in section 2, or joins an existing authority in the manner provided in section 3.

(d) “Municipal emergency service” means an emergency service performed by a municipality, rather than by an authority.

(e) “Municipality” means a county, city, village, or township.


History: 1988, Act 57, Eff. Apr. 1, 1988
